Understanding skin tags in dogs
Skin tags in dogs are small,soft growths that hang from the skin. While they are usually harmless, they can sometiems be irritating to your furry friend. If you’re wondering how to remove a skin tag from your dog, ther are a few options available.
One option is to have your veterinarian remove the skin tag:
- Your vet can perform a fast and simple procedure to remove the skin tag safely.
- They may use a local anesthetic to numb the area before removing the skin tag.
Common causes of skin tags in dogs
Skin tags in dogs are benign growths that can be quite common, with various factors contributing to their development. Some of the most include genetics, age, obesity, and hormonal changes. genetics play a meaningful role in the development of skin tags, as certain breeds are more prone to them than others. additionally, older dogs are more likely to develop skin tags, as well as overweight dogs due to the excess skin rubbing together. Hormonal changes, such as during pregnancy or puberty, can also trigger the growth of skin tags in dogs.
If you’re wondering how to remove a skin tag from your dog, there are several options available.One method is to have the skin tag removed by a veterinarian using surgical procedures such as freezing, cauterization, or surgical excision. Another option is to use over-the-counter remedies specifically designed to safely remove skin tags from dogs. It’s important to consult with a vet before attempting to remove a skin tag at home to ensure the safety and well-being of your furry friend.

Preventative measures to avoid skin tags in dogs
one effective way to prevent skin tags in dogs is by maintaining a healthy weight for your furry friend. Obesity can lead to skin folds and friction, which can increase the likelihood of skin tags forming. Make sure to provide a balanced diet and regular exercise to keep your dog at a healthy weight.
Another preventative measure is to regularly groom your dog and keep their skin clean and dry. This can help prevent irritation and skin infections that may lead to the development of skin tags. Additionally, be mindful of any changes in your dog’s skin, including new growths or abnormalities, and consult with your vet if you have any concerns. By taking these proactive steps, you can help keep your dog’s skin healthy and minimize the risk of skin tags.

Q: What are some common methods for removing skin tags from dogs?
A: Common methods for removing skin tags from dogs include surgical removal, cryotherapy (freezing the tag off), or cauterization (burning the tag off). Your veterinarian will advise on the best method for your dog’s specific situation.
Q: Are skin tags in dogs perilous?
A: Skin tags in dogs are typically benign and not dangerous. However, if the tag is causing irritation, bleeding, or appears to be growing rapidly, it is important to have it checked by a vet to rule out any underlying issues.
